In the rapidly evolving tech landscape of 2025, cloud computing remains a cornerstone for developers seeking scalability, flexibility, and efficiency. Whether you're a student embarking on your coding journey or a seasoned professional, selecting the right cloud platform is crucial for your project's success. This guide delves into the top cloud computing platforms that are shaping the development world this year.
Top Cloud Platforms for Developers in 2025
1. Amazon Web Services (AWS)
As a pioneer in cloud services, AWS continues to lead with its extensive suite of tools catering to developers. From EC2 for scalable computing to Lambda for serverless applications, AWS offers robust solutions for diverse development needs.
2. Microsoft Azure
Azure stands out with its seamless integration with Microsoft's ecosystem, making it a preferred choice for enterprises. Its support for various programming languages and frameworks empowers developers to build versatile applications.
3. Google Cloud Platform (GCP)
GCP excels in data analytics and machine learning services. With tools like BigQuery and TensorFlow, developers can harness powerful analytics and AI capabilities to enhance their applications.
4. IBM Cloud
IBM Cloud offers a hybrid cloud environment, allowing developers to build and deploy applications across public and private clouds. Its emphasis on AI and blockchain technologies provides innovative avenues for development.
5. DigitalOcean
Known for its simplicity and developer-friendly approach, DigitalOcean is ideal for startups and small businesses. Its straightforward interface and competitive pricing make cloud deployment accessible to all.
Choosing the Right Platform
Selecting the appropriate cloud platform depends on your project's specific requirements, budget, and desired features. Consider factors such as scalability, support for programming languages, and available development tools when making your choice.
Enhance Your Skills with Our Courses
To effectively leverage these cloud platforms, it's essential to have a solid understanding of cloud computing concepts. Explore our comprehensive courses designed to equip you with the necessary skills:
Frequently Asked Questions
- Which cloud platform is best for beginners?
- DigitalOcean is often recommended for beginners due to its user-friendly interface and straightforward setup process.
- Can I switch between cloud platforms?
- Yes, many cloud platforms support interoperability, but migrating services may require careful planning and potential adjustments to your applications.
- Are there free tiers available for these platforms?
- Most major cloud providers offer free tiers with limited resources, allowing developers to experiment and learn without incurring costs.
Comments (0)